Description
This is a Notice of Intent, not a request for proposal. The National Institute of Allergy and Infectious Diseases (NIAID) of the National Institutes of Health (NIH) intends to negotiate on an other than full and open competition basis with OZGENE PTY LTD for the following services:
Gene targeting vector services for Conditional Knock-in of IRES_eYFP_BGHpA (yeti) into the Ifng Gene and Knock-in of Cre and Conditional Knock-in of Tet-inducible Yeti into the Ifng
J&A: The National Institute of Allergy and Infectious Diseases (NIAID) Fungal Pathogenesis Section (FPS) research is broadly focused on characterization of immune response against debilitating fungal infections with an aim to improve patient outcomes via identifying at-risk patient population for early prophylaxis and uncover novel molecules that will aid in development of new immunotherapeutic modalities. This project is focused on understanding the pathophysiological mechanisms of STAT1 GOF mutations associated with defective mucosal immunity to C. albicans. This project has important implications in the medical mycology and mucosal immunology fields for: i) the possible development of novel therapeutic strategies based on the understanding of the pathophysiology mechanisms of STAT1 GOF mutations in mice; ii) the discovery of novel biomarkers for diagnostics; iii) better genetic counselling; and iv) better follow-up and outcomes of the patients. A strong motivation to establish this mouse model through Ozgene-s gene targeting vector services is for the generation of a conditional knockout mouse that allows a temporally and spatially controlled Jak1 gene expression in somatic tissues. This is as a follow-on to projects and studies previously conducted by Ozgene Pty Ltd in the scope of a larger project.
